Abstract

This research paper investigates the pivotal role of education and awareness campaigns in influencing consumer behavior towards green products. As sustainability becomes increasingly important in consumer's decision making; it is an understanding the effectiveness of educational initiatives in promoting eco-friendly consumption is crucial for businesses and policy-makers. Through a comprehensive review of existing literature; this paper examines the mechanisms by which education and awareness campaigns impact consumer's perceptions, attitudes, and purchasing decisions regarding green products. Furthermore, it explores best practices and strategies for designing and implementing effective educational interventions to foster sustainable consumption patterns. By synthesizing insights from various disciplines including marketing, psychology, and environmental studies; this paper offers valuable insights for practitioners and policy-makers seeking to promote sustainability through consumer education!!!
